Film

 

I am in the process of working on a short animated film by artist and director Joanna Korus called ‘Once Upon O’Clock’, the story of a young girl who has long admired the family heirloom, but in an attempt to finally hold this clock she drops and breaks it. She and her grandfather then go on an enchanted journey to fix the broken clock. The director has asked for an orchestral score, with a modernised Disney style. The project is set to be complete in the second half of 2023. 

Another project I have recently started work on is a horror film called ‘Wiccan’ directed by Martin Handsley.

Independent Musician

 

Since graduating, I have extended my skills as a songwriter, producer and performer to write and release my EP ‘Stories Left Untold’ which was featured on a BBC York radio show. I was later interviewed on the same show and performed 2 songs live with my backing band on the radio. 

All music written under my artist name George Wilks can be found from the links at the bottom of this document. My music is inspired by artists such as Jamie Cullum, Coldplay, Tom Misch, Sam Wills and Rhys Lewis and is a mixture of pop, jazz, soul and R&B. 

This project provided an opportunity to research and use social media platforms (Instagram, TikTok, Facebook and YouTube) and the principles of marketing and business decision-making. My presence on these platforms led to become a featured performing artist on a ‘Tango’ delivering streams in a regular slot every week.
